A virtual dataroom can be an excellent tool for business transactions. It allows investors and due-diligence teams to review documents, without divulging confidential information. It also assists the legal department track the activity of users and any changes made to documents for compliance purposes. A VDR with a modern interface that is able to be used on any device is ideal since it gives users the flexibility to work in their preferred workflows. Choose a vendor that allows for preferred integrations with other applications and tools like Microsoft OneDrive, Slack, and many more.

The investment due diligence process can take time and requires access to a large quantity of documents. A VDR that includes content management features can aid an investment due diligence team review documents more efficiently and concentrate on the more important aspects of evaluation. A well-organized taxonomy system, for instance, makes it simpler to categorize documents, and filter them by type, industry or region.

The most effective M&A VDRs provide concrete information to keep the deal moving. A VDR that allows the deal maker to discover the pages their website prospective buyers will visit can help them anticipate queries and prepare answers in advance. This can keep the prospective buyer interested for longer and help them maintain their faith in the deal. This could be a factor in the case of a deal being closed or not. A M&A VDR that offers top-notch security is essential. Find a company with a custom-designed permission control, ISO 27001 certification, the 256-bit encryption feature and built-in security of the infrastructure.
